Transaction d51b69ce20719007da887443097a6f93c0f0ff43b62f49935e21a0949b76d250
1 Input
2 Outputs
- d51b69ce20719007da887443097a6f93c0f0ff43b62f49935e21a0949b76d250:0
- d51b69ce20719007da887443097a6f93c0f0ff43b62f49935e21a0949b76d250:1
value 1488883
address 189rKdVvGsZ5peAjgjkPQ5y4drJuiuB4cw
value 402101298
address 1DadkAHiVv4sLquH8yBthNeA5Xoge1N6N1